
Lafayette Roadway Set to Close for Construction of Louisiana’s First Buc-ee’s
LAFAYETTE, La. – Construction for Louisiana’s first Buc-ee’s is officially underway in Lafayette, and with it comes a temporary road closure that will impact local traffic for several weeks.
According to the Lafayette Consolidated Government, East Pont Des Mouton Road will be closed between Louisiana Avenue and Shadow Bluff Drive beginning Monday, March 24, through Sunday, April 7. The closure is necessary for utility infrastructure work that supports the large-scale Buc-ee’s development.
Detour routes will be clearly marked, directing drivers to use Louisiana Avenue and Shadow Bluff Drive. While through traffic will be restricted, local access will be maintained for residents living on the north side of East Pont Des Mouton Road.
Motorists are urged to use caution when traveling near the construction zone and to allow additional travel time while the detours are in place.
The new Buc-ee’s, planned for a 42-acre site at the northeast corner of I-10 and Louisiana Avenue, marks the convenience chain’s first location in Louisiana. Known for its massive footprint, multiple rows of fuel pumps, and delicious retail offerings, Buc-ee’s is expected to bring significant traffic and economic activity to the area.
Construction of the Lafayette Buc-ee’s is projected to be completed by mid-2026.
